a) Preheat your oven to 220°C/200°C fan/gas mark 7. Boil a full kettle.
b) Lay the salmon fillets, skin-side down, onto a lined baking tray. Drizzle over a little oil, then season with salt and pepper.
c) When the oven is hot, roast the salmon on the top shelf until cooked through, 10-15 mins. IMPORTANT: Wash your hands and equipment after handling raw fish. It's cooked when opaque in the middle.
a) Pour the boiled water from your kettle into a medium saucepan with 1/2 tsp salt and bring to a boil.
b) Add the noodles and cook until tender, 4 mins.
c) Once cooked, drain in a sieve and run under cold water to stop them sticking together.
a) While the fish and noodles cook, peel and grate the garlic (or use a garlic press). Slice the young pea pods in half widthways. Drain the prawns.
b) Heat a drizzle of oil in a large frying pan on medium-high heat.
c) Once hot, add the prawns and pea pods and stir-fry until tender, 2-3 mins. IMPORTANT: Wash hands and utensils after handling raw prawns.
a) Add the garlic, coleslaw mix and Thai style spice blend to the pea pods. Stir-fry for 30 secs more.
b) Stir in the teriyaki sauce, hoisin sauce, soy and water for the sauce (see pantry for amount). Bring to the boil, then lower the heat and simmer for 4-5 mins. IMPORTANT: Cook so the prawns are opaque in the middle.
a) Add the cooked noodles to the sauce and veg, mixing together well so the noodles are coated in the sauce.
a) Share the prawn noodles between your bowls and top with the salmon.
b) Drizzle the sweet chilli over the salmon, then finish by sprinkling the sesame seeds over everything.
